@import url(https://fonts.googleapis.com/css2?family=DM+Sans:ital,opsz,wght@0,9..40,100..1000;1,9..40,100..1000&family=Open+Sans:ital,wght@0,300..800;1,300..800&family=Raleway:ital,wght@0,100..900;1,100..900&display=swap);@import url(https://fonts.googleapis.com/css2?family=Open+Sans:ital,wght@0,300..800;1,300..800&family=Raleway:ital,wght@0,100..900;1,100..900&display=swap);body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;margin:0}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}:root{--input-width:48px}.sudoku-container{margin:10px auto}.sudoku-table{border:2px solid #000;border-collapse:collapse;border-spacing:0;transition:all .5s}.sudoku-cell{border:1px solid #484f51;text-align:center;vertical-align:middle}.error-text{font-size:16px}.sudoku-cell input{background-color:#fffbfb;border:0;color:#000;color:#333;font-family:DM Sans,sans-serif;font-size:30px;height:48px;outline:none;padding:0;text-align:center;text-transform:uppercase;transition:all .5s;width:48px}.sudoku-cell input:focus{background-color:#e3e3e3}.sudoku-cell input:disabled{background-color:#bbdefb}.sudoku-table tr:nth-child(3n){border-bottom:3px solid #484f51}.sudoku-table tr:nth-child(3n+1){border-top:3px solid #484f51}.sudoku-table td:nth-child(3n){border-right:3px solid #484f51}.sudoku-table td:nth-child(3n+1){border-left:3px solid #484f51}@media screen and (max-width:540px){.sudoku-cell input{--input-width:30px;font-size:18px;height:30px;width:30px}.error-text{font-size:12px!important}}@media screen and (max-width:390px){.sudoku-container{margin:20px auto}.error-text{font-size:12px!important}.sudoku-cell input{--input-width:22px;font-size:18px;height:20px;width:22px}}.alert-error{max-width:432px;max-width:calc(var(--input-width)*9)}.wrapper-div{align-items:center;background-color:#eff8ec;display:flex;flex-direction:column;justify-content:center;min-height:100vh}.wrapper-div,body,html{margin:0!important;padding:0!important}body,html{overflow-x:hidden}.heading{color:#73c992;font-optical-sizing:auto;font-size:40px;font-style:normal;font-weight:700}.heading,.helpline{font-family:Raleway,sans-serif}.helpline{font-optical-sizing:auto;font-size:20px;font-style:normal}.delete-btn,.upload-button,button{background-color:#6477b9!important;border:#7d8cc4!important;border-radius:10px!important;font-family:Raleway,sans-serif;font-style:normal;vertical-align:middle}.delete-btn :hover,.upload-button:hover,button :hover{border:#6477b9!important;cursor:pointer}.modal-close{background-color:initial!important}.captured-image{position:relative;width:-webkit-fit-content;width:-moz-fit-content;width:fit-content}.delete-btn{background-color:#cc7e85!important;bottom:-40px;position:absolute;right:0}.image-section{align-items:center;display:flex;justify-content:center}.spinner{height:40px;margin:30px auto;position:relative;width:40px}.double-bounce1,.double-bounce2{animation:sk-bounce 2s ease-in-out infinite;background-color:#333;border-radius:50%;height:100%;left:0;opacity:.6;position:absolute;top:0;width:100%}.double-bounce2{animation-delay:-1s}@keyframes sk-bounce{0%,to{transform:scale(0);-webkit-transform:scale(0)}50%{transform:scale(1);-webkit-transform:scale(1)}}.loader-div{align-items:center;display:flex;flex-direction:column;flex-wrap:wrap;justify-content:center}.loader-text{font-family:Raleway,sans-serif;font-size:20px;font-style:normal;font-weight:500}
/*# sourceMappingURL=main.62119bd3.css.map*/